Drive Motor Over Temperature
The P0A2F code indicates that the drive motor temperature has exceeded the safe operating threshold. This is typically detected by a temperature sensor within the motor assembly. Overheating can be caused by excessive load, cooling system failure, or internal motor faults. If ignored, it can lead to permanent motor damage.
1. Symptoms You Will Notice
- Check Engine Light on
- Reduced motor power or performance
- Warning message on dashboard
- Possible motor shutdown
2. Most Common Causes
- Faulty electric motor cooling system (defective coolant pump, blocked circuit)
- Low or degraded coolant in the motor cooling system
- Faulty motor 'A' temperature sensor (erratic or out-of-range signal)
- Abnormal stator winding resistance due to insulation degradation
- Prolonged motor overload from severe driving conditions (steep grades, excessive towing)
- Failed inverter control module or thermal management system
- Contaminant buildup or debris on the electric motor radiator/heat exchanger
- Failed cooling system electric fan
3. Step-by-Step Diagnosis
Step 1: Scan for additional codes and check freeze frame data.
Step 2: Inspect coolant level and condition; check for leaks.
Step 3: Test coolant pump operation and verify flow.
Step 4: Check motor temperature sensor resistance and wiring.
Step 5: Perform a road test to monitor temperature under load.
4. Frequently Asked Questions
Is it safe to drive with this code?▼
No, driving with an overheated drive motor can cause permanent damage. Stop driving and have the vehicle towed to a repair shop.
How much does it cost to fix?▼
Diagnosis typically costs $50-$150. Repairs vary: coolant pump replacement $200-$500, sensor replacement $100-$300, or more for motor issues.
